What are Digital Twins?
Digital twins are virtual representations of physical objects, processes, or systems. They use real-time data and simulation to mirror the behavior, performance, and characteristics of their physical counterparts.
The concept of digital twins isn’t entirely new, but recent advancements in Internet of Things (IoT), Artificial Intelligence (AI), Big Data Analytics, and Tracking Technologies have unlocked their full potential. By harnessing data from sensors, GPS trackers, RFID tags, and other sources, logistics companies can create highly accurate digital twins that reflect the current state of their operations. Real-Time Visibility and Predictive Analytics
One of the key benefits of digital twins in logistics is enhanced visibility. By continuously collecting and analyzing data from various sources, digital twins provide real-time insights into the status and performance of assets and processes across the supply chain. For instance, a digital twin of a warehouse can monitor inventory levels, track the movement of goods, and predict potential disruptions.
This visibility enables logistics managers to make informed decisions quickly. They can proactively address issues such as delays, stockouts, or capacity constraints before they escalate, thus optimizing operations and minimizing costs. Moreover, digital twins facilitate predictive analytics by leveraging historical data to forecast future trends and demand patterns.
Optimized Supply Chain Management
Digital twins empower logistics companies to optimize their supply chain management processes. By simulating different scenarios and conducting “what-if” analyses, organizations can identify bottlenecks, streamline workflows, and optimize resource allocation. For example, a digital twin of a transportation network can simulate alternative routes or modes of transport to minimize delivery times and reduce fuel consumption.
Furthermore, digital twins facilitate scenario planning for risk management. By modeling various supply chain disruptions such as natural disasters or supplier failures, logistics professionals can develop contingency plans and improve overall resilience.
Warehouse Management and Inventory Optimization
In the realm of warehouse management, digital twins offer substantial benefits. They enable real-time monitoring of inventory levels, location tracking of goods, and optimization of storage space. By simulating warehouse layouts and operational workflows, companies can identify opportunities to enhance efficiency and reduce operational costs.
Digital twins also support inventory optimization by analyzing demand patterns and automatically triggering reorder points. This proactive approach helps minimize stockouts and excess inventory, leading to improved customer satisfaction and reduced carrying costs.
Fleet Management and Route Optimization
For logistics companies with extensive transportation networks, digital twins can play a crucial role in fleet management and route optimization. By creating digital twins of vehicles and integrating real-time data on traffic conditions and weather forecasts, organizations can optimize delivery routes to minimize travel time and fuel consumption.
Additionally, digital twins enhance vehicle maintenance by monitoring performance metrics such as fuel efficiency and engine health. Predictive maintenance alerts based on digital twin data help prevent breakdowns and reduce downtime, ensuring fleet reliability and operational continuity.
Enhanced Collaboration and Stakeholder Engagement
Another compelling aspect of digital twins in logistics is improved collaboration and stakeholder engagement. By providing a shared platform with real-time data and analytics, digital twins facilitate collaboration between different stakeholders such as suppliers, carriers, and customers.
For example, a digital twin of a supply chain network enables suppliers to monitor production schedules and adjust deliveries accordingly. Similarly, customers can track the status of their orders and receive accurate delivery estimates, leading to enhanced transparency and customer satisfaction.
Challenges and Future Outlook with Digital Twins in Logistics
Despite their immense potential, implementing digital twins in logistics comes with certain challenges. This includes the integration of disparate data sources, ensuring data security and privacy, and overcoming organizational resistance to change. However, with proper planning, investment, and collaboration, these challenges can be addressed effectively.
